Sims 4 CC doesn't show after June 2020 update

★★★ Newbie

Ever since I updated (which I waited until I HAD to, and now my entire game is RUINED-the June 2020 update), NONE of my CC shows up in CAS. Yes, it's in the correct folder. Yes, laptop mode is off. And yes, settings are set to "ultra". I deleted ALL my CC (after I updated), and re-downloaded new stuff after learning I wouldn't be able to use what I previously had any longer, and it still does not work. I'm so irritated at this; the update and the whole game itself. EA: PLEASE FIX THIS-ASAP. I've spent hours on end downloading things, subscribed to creators, researched why this isn't working trying to find an answer to see if anyone else is having this problem and am not finding any fixes. The closest issue somebody else had that I found was that their CC actually SHOWED in CAS...it just wouldn't appear on the character. They would select a custom eye color, and get the standard game eye. Sooo... EA? Help? Anybody?!

@sweeetsarah It's true that some CC was broken by the last game patch. Here's a list:

 

https://forums.thesims.com/en_US/discussion/976565/broken-updated-mods-cc-june-20-eco-lifestyle-patc...

 

All of my mods and CC seem to be working fine so far. I updated many of my mods but none of my CC was on that list so I'm just using the same stuff as before the patch. Can you double-check to see if CC is still enabled in your Game Options in the "Other" tab? Origin has a sneaky way of disabling mods and CC during patch updates. Also, can you verify that you still have a Resource.cfg file in your Mods folder?

 

One more thing to check-- if you are on PC, can you verify the location of your Sims 4 user folder? Sometimes the game will start to use a different user folder, ie something on the cloud like OneDrive. If your game is using a Mods folder on OneDrive then it will not see any CC you have added to your old Mods folder in your Documents folder. Here's a link on how to find out which folder your game is currently using:
